South Dakota's single 605 area code covers two very different economies. Sioux Falls has built a serious financial-services and healthcare hub — bank operations centers, credit-card servicing, and two major health systems radiating clinics across the region — plus the professional firms that grow up around them. Out west, Rapid City anchors the Black Hills tourism economy, regional healthcare, and Ellsworth-adjacent contractors. Between them, agriculture: co-ops, implement dealers, grain and cattle operations that run on phone calls at planting and harvest. fvoip serves all of it from one platform with flat per-user pricing.

What is South Dakota's call recording law?
South Dakota is a one-party consent state — you may record calls you are a party to without notifying the other person. If your team records calls into all-party consent states, fvoip's automatic disclosure announcement covers those conversations.
